GASKET FOR A BALL VALVE
Disclosed is a gasket for a ball valve including: a valve body; a ball rotatable housed in the valve body; a first and a second seat positioned inside the valve body and housing the ball; and a seal of the type including a first and a second gasket interposed between the first and the second seat and the ball. Each gasket is a one-piece composite gasket and includes at least a first layer and a second layer made of thermoplastic materials, where the hardness, tensile strength and coefficient of friction values are different between the first and second layer, and where the first layer has lower values and coacts in a fluid-tight manner directly with the ball, while the second layer has higher values, normally acts as support for the first layer and coacts in a fluid-tight manner with the ball only upon reaching given operating conditions.

Sintered Valve Seat Insert and Method of Manufacture Thereof
A powder admixture useful for making a sintered valve seat insert includes a first iron-base powder and second iron-base powder wherein the first iron-base powder has a higher hardness than the second iron-base powder, the first iron-base powder including, in weight percent, 1-2% C, 10-25% Cr, 5-20% Mo, 15-25% Co, and 30-60 wt. % Fe, and the second iron-base powder including, in weight %, 1-1.5% C, 3-15% Cr, 5-7% Mo, 3-6% W, 1-1.7% V, and 60-85% Fe. The powder admixture can be sintered to form a sintered valve seat insert optionally infiltrated with copper.

ADDITIVELY MANUFACTURED VALVE SEATS AND SEALS INCLUDING A METAL-THERMOPLASTIC COMPOSITE
The disclosure provides for sealing systems including a composite material that includes a thermoplastic lattice structure having interstitial space that is filled with fusible metal. The composite material is formed by additively manufacturing the lattice structure, and then filling the interstitial space with the metal. The composite material may be used to form portions of valves and seals.
